1 clinic specializing in Oncology and Spine surgery providing treatment of Spinal metastases Spinal metastases are cancerous tumors that spread to the spine from primary cancer sites. They can compress the spinal cord and nerves, causing pain, weakness, and sensory changes, and may necessitate treatments such as radiation therapy or surgery. disease in Puebla.
